Snake Island, Brazil

Just off the coast of Brazil lies a small island that is home to one of the deadliest creatures on earth: the golden lancehead viper. This snake is so venomous that just one bite can kill a human within minutes. It is said that its poison can even melt human flesh.

The island, known as Snake Island, is uninhabited by humans and is home to thousands of these snakes, roughly five per square meter. In addition to the golden lancehead viper, Snake Island is also home to a number of other dangerous creatures, including the Brazilian rattlesnake and the boa constrictor. These snakes are not as deadly as the golden lancehead viper, but they can still pose a serious threat to humans.
